Job Purpose:
The Sr. Manager, Digital Partnerships will manage critical digital distribution partnerships with traditional and emerging online video distributors and will partner closely with Business Development and Legal teams on the multi-platform distribution strategies for NBCU's TV portfolio and streaming products. The Sr. Manager will work cross-functionally with our Marketing, Operations, Product, Research and Business Development teams to support products and content initiatives that reinforce the value of the NBCUniversal portfolio with our distribution partners. The successful candidate will act as a subject matter expert and product champion communicating across all key stakeholders and will be responsible for the performance and profitability of their projects.

Essential Responsibilities:
• Define and provide insight on digital terms to support MVPD and vMVPD distribution renewals in collaboration with internal Business Development and Legal teams.
• Maintain strategic relationships with digital counterparts at distribution partners and drive multi-platform video viewership and monetization through collaborative programming and product-development initiatives and successful cultivation of on-going internal and external partnerships.
• Utilize data insights, competitive analysis and market trends to assess fit, feasibility, and financial impact of product and partnership growth opportunities. Track and analyze partner usage and pull data insights that illustrate the impact of partner activations on distributor platforms.
• Work closely with internal and external stakeholders on key distributor initiatives and ensure clear communication, monitor developments and ensure ongoing alignment with deal commitments.
• Lead client Quarterly Product Reviews, which include partnership recaps, data/insights, and new product/content opportunities.
• Gather business requirements across distributors and internal teams (e.g. Operations, Product, Marketing) to help drive product roadmaps and process improvements, as well as identify new opportunities for our content.
• Partner with Tech & Ops teams to ensure that product deployments perform in accordance with client expectations and content distribution rights, understanding contractual commitments.
